INSOLE HAVING LIQUID THEREIN
An insole having liquid therein may include a main body that has an enclosing layer covering an outer surface of the main body, and liquid is enclosed by the enclosing layer. In one embodiment, the liquid can be water or oil. The insole may also have at least one hole located at a predetermined position of enclosing layer to evenly distribute the pressure from the user's feet. A sealing edge is formed at an outer portion of the main body and a pressing portion is formed at a periphery of the holes.

The present invention relates to an insole, and more particularly to an insole including liquid therein to increase the comfort level when the user wears the shoes.
B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TIONWhen people are engaging in strenuous exercises such as running or jumping, the feet have to sustain a huge level of pressure, so the feet are very vulnerable to sport injuries, which can be caused mostly by improper posture and poorly designed shoes. For example, when people jump, the landing foot will naturally buffer the impact due to reflection. However, when emergency happens and there is insufficient time to react, the shoes have to buffer the impact for the user. Thus, there are a lot of shoes equipped with air cushion to protect the user's feet from being injured. However, the air cushion is mostly equipped with the sneakers but not other footwear such as casual shoes. More importantly, according to recent medical studies, foot injuries can be caused not only through exercise, but also through daily walking. Even though walking is not as intensive as exercise, people may have to walk for at least hundred steps everyday, which may continuously cause injuries to the feet since most of the casual shoes do not have the cushion to buffer the impact. While the casual shoes may include a pad inside, it is used to enhance the comfort level of wearing, not used to absorb the impact while walking. Therefore, there remains a need for a new and improved insole to overcome the problems stated above.

In one embodiment, the size of the main body is corresponding to the user's feet, wherein the main body can be inserted between a shoe main body and a shoe base, so when the user wears the shoes, the user's feet can feel the elasticity of the main body.
In another embodiment, the size of the main body is corresponding to the user's feet of the rear portion. Likewise, a sealing edge is formed at an outer portion of the main body and a pressing portion is formed at a periphery of holes. An enclosing layer encloses the liquid. Furthermore, the shoe base has a recessed slot corresponding to the size of the user's foot at the rear portion and the main body is inserted into the recessed slot so the user's rear feet can feel the elasticity of the main body.
